#hash-table #open #tutorial #collision #resolution #addressing #crafting

caffeine

使用开放寻址的简单哈希表实现。为与我的工艺解释器教程实现一起使用而编写。

1 个不稳定版本

0.1.3 2024 年 8 月 6 日
0.1.2 2024 年 8 月 6 日
0.1.1 2024 年 7 月 28 日
0.1.0 2024 年 7 月 24 日

#1 in #addressing

Download history 275/week @ 2024-07-22 56/week @ 2024-07-29 244/week @ 2024-08-05

575 次每月下载

自定义许可证

1.5MB
289

Rust 中简单的哈希表实现。虽然开放寻址是一个愚蠢的想法,但用于冲突解决(即使开放寻址是一个愚蠢的想法)。为与我的工艺解释器教程实现一起使用而编写。

命名为咖啡因,因为我在制作这个库的那个晚上,不小心喝了太多咖啡,我的手都在颤抖。最初我将其命名为“颤抖”,但后来改为咖啡因,这样我就可以在 crates.io 上从一个名称抢注者那里抢注库的名字。

故事发生了什么事是我用完了咖啡过滤器,决定不加过滤器直接冲泡咖啡,希望一切都会好。当我喝的时候,我开始立即调整。味道太差,我打字都很困难,甚至很难集中注意力在做的事情上 lmao

我开始写这个的时候

依赖项